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Dublin Primary School (Dublin, NC)
Dublin Primary School is situated in the small, close-knit community of Dublin, North Carolina, located within Bladen County. The primary access route to Dublin is via US Highway 701, which runs north to south through the county, and NC Highway 41, which intersects with 701 and provides access to surrounding towns. The nearest major airport serving the region is Fayetteville Regional Airport (FAY), approximately a 30-40 minute drive northeast of Dublin, offering connections to larger hubs. For those driving, I-95 is about an hour's drive to the east, providing a major north-south corridor. Parking is generally available directly at the school for events, with additional street parking in the immediate vicinity. Traffic flow is typically light, but can increase around school pick-up and drop-off times, as well as during larger community events held at the school. It's advisable to arrive a few minutes early for school-related activities to ensure you find convenient parking.
Lodging contextWhere to Stay Near Dublin Primary School
Dublin, NC, is a rural community, and hotel accommodations are not immediately adjacent to Dublin Primary School. The closest cluster of hotels is found in nearby cities such as Elizabethtown, about a 15-20 minute drive to the south, or Whiteville, roughly a 30-minute drive southwest. These areas offer a range of standard hotel chains suitable for travelers. Due to the limited accommodation options directly in Dublin, booking in advance is strongly recommended, especially during peak seasons or when the school hosts significant events like tournaments or county fairs. Utilizing map filters for proximity to US-701 or NC-41 can help narrow down choices in the surrounding towns. Staying in Elizabethtown or Whiteville provides a good balance between convenience and availability for visitors attending events at Dublin Primary School.

Weather & Seasons at Dublin Primary School
- Winter: Winter in Dublin brings cool to cold temperatures, with average highs in the 50s and lows in the 30s Fahrenheit. Layers are essential, including sweaters, jackets, and possibly a heavier coat for colder days. Outdoor events may require extra warm clothing, and participants should be prepared for crisp air. Short daylight hours mean that late afternoon events might feel chilly.
- Spring & early summer: Spring offers mild and increasingly warm weather, with temperatures gradually rising into the 60s and 70s. Lightweight jackets or long-sleeved shirts are usually sufficient. Early summer continues this trend, becoming warmer and more humid. Outdoor activities become more comfortable, though sun protection is increasingly important.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er is characterized by significant heat and humidity, with average temperatures frequently in the upper 80s and 90s Fahrenheit. Light, breathable clothing like shorts and t-shirts are recommended. Staying hydrated is crucial for any outdoor activities, and events may be scheduled for cooler parts of the day or have indoor components to provide relief from the heat.
- Fall season: Fall brings a welcome drop in temperature and humidity, with daytime highs typically in the 70s and cooling into the 50s and 60s in the evenings. This season is often ideal for outdoor events, with comfortable conditions for participants. Light sweaters or jackets are useful for cooler mornings and evenings.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ible year-round in Dublin, though more frequent in spring and summer. Visitors should pack a light rain jacket or umbrella. Snowfall is infrequent and usually light during the winter months, rarely causing significant disruption, but it's wise to check forecasts for any potential icy conditions that could affect travel.
